Legacy and Future Prospects of NVIDIA NVLink
Legacy of NVIDIA NVLink
The NVIDIA NVLink technology was first introduced by NVIDIA Corporation in 2016 as a high-bandwidth communication protocol designed to surmount the limitations posed by PCI Express in high-performance computing environments. Initially integrated into the Pascal microarchitecture, NVLink allowed for significantly faster data transfer rates between GPUs and CPUs, thereby enhancing the computational capabilities and efficiency of Graphics Processing Units (GPUs).
The introduction of NVLink represented a pivotal shift in the landscape of computing, especially in fields that demanded intensive computational power such as scientific research, deep learning, and artificial intelligence. NVLink enabled seamless scaling by interconnecting multiple GPUs, providing a multi-lane, near-range serial communication link. This was a significant improvement over traditional methods, as it allowed for collective resource usage and improved data coherency among connected devices.
Historical Development
The development of NVLink can be traced through a series of advances in NVIDIA's GPU architectures. NVLink 1.0, introduced with the Pascal GPUs, provided a data rate of 20 GB/s per link. This was followed by the Volta microarchitecture, which saw the introduction of NVLink 2.0. This version doubled the data rate to 50 GB/s per link and incorporated additional features such as cache coherency, which further optimized the performance of systems using NVIDIA's DGX systems.
NVLink continued to evolve with the Ampere architecture, featuring NVLink 3.0. This iteration offered even higher bandwidth, enhancing data throughput and making it ideal for demanding applications. However, with the release of the latest Ada Lovelace and Hopper architectures, NVIDIA has begun to phase out NVLink in some consumer-grade products like the GeForce RTX 40 series, focusing its implementation more on specialized systems and data centers.
Future Prospects
The future of NVLink appears to be geared towards specialized high-performance applications rather than consumer-grade GPUs. With advancements in quantum computing and growing demands for more efficient data centers, NVLink is set to play a crucial role. The upcoming NVLink 4.0 and 5.0 versions, as hinted by NVIDIA, are expected to offer even higher data rates and improved interoperability with other high-bandwidth interfaces like NV-HBI.
Moreover, the integration of NVLink with future technologies like 5G and edge computing could open new avenues for real-time data processing and internet of things (IoT) applications. The potential to link multiple GPUs and CPUs in a coherent network will continue to provide significant advantages in areas requiring extensive parallel processing capabilities.
The commitment to innovation in NVLink's development signifies NVIDIA's endeavor to maintain its leadership in the high-performance computing market. As computational needs evolve, NVLink is poised to become integral to the architecture of next-generation supercomputers and specialized AI systems.